Default What custom feed uri value should I use?

Hello,
I am having an issue with my Feedburner feed and need to make sure I have the correct value in my Theme Settings.

For Custom Feeds, I have the following: www.twsssports.com/feed
Feedburner feed is: http://feeds.feedburner.com/TWSSSports

Which uri should I use?

You need to fill in the feedburner feed, because it is the custom one.

The first one is the default WP feed.
